On The Legal Regime Of Maritime Performing Party Under The Rotterdam Rules

In order to make a truly unified maritime legal regime for the international carriage ofgoods and balance the interests between the ship and the interests of cargo as far as possible,UNCITRAL adopts United Nations Convention on Contracts for the International Carriage ofGoods Wholly or Partly by Sea--the Rotterdam Rules on11December2008. Maritimeperforming party regime is one of the innovative regimes in the Rotterdam Rules,UNCITRAL meticulously conducted a questionnaire survey, discussed and drafted on theconcept, legal status, responsibility regime of maritime performing party. If we can introducethe maritime performing party regime to solve the problems existing in actual carrier regimeand the port operator regime in our country, not only it’s conducive to complete our maritimelegal regime, but also can greatly promote our shipping industry’s prosperity anddevelopment. However, the maritime performing party regime scatters in every chapter in theRotterdam rules and doesn’t form a system, therefore, this paper hope it could present theclear and complete system of maritime performing party regime through a comprehensive,complete sorting of maritime performing party regime’s entity content, and provide effectivesuggestions for the modification of the related regime in our maritime law.This paper studies the maritime performing party regime in Rotterdam rules through thecomparative method, the deductive method, inductive method, model method and othermethods. The views of on maritime performing party regime are quite complex, so this paperonly adopts the mainstream views, then sums up the views which I support after acomprehensive study.Besides the introduction and conclusion, the paper is divided into five chapters, a total of25,071words.The first chapter through the analysis of the interpretation on the definition and legalstatus of maritime performing party of domestic and foreign scholars, we know the maritimeperforming party only covers two compliance assistants--the independent contractors and thecarrier’s agents engaged in carriage of goods by sea, including maritime carrier, port operator,stevedoring company, warehouse company, etc. They are protected by “Himalaya Clause”, and the carrier and the maritime performing party’s servants may not be sued as maritimeperforming party.The second chapter first analyzes two groups of legal relationship involving maritimeperforming party. On this basis, it analyzes the main or changed rights and obligations ofmaritime performing party in Rotterdam rules, such as exemption right, the seaworthinessobligation and the relationship among seaworthiness obligation, obligation of management ofcargo and exemption right.The third chapter mainly researches the liability regime of maritime performing party,including the liability in different situations, the legal basis of maritime performing party’sliability, and the joint and several liability between the carrier and maritime performing party.The fourth chapter analyzes the existing problems referring to the maritime performingparty regime in our maritime law. It mainly relates to actual carrier regime and port operatorregime--it is difficult to define and identify the actual carrier in practice, and the portoperator is often excluded from the actual carrier, so that they take the high risks which do notmatch their income.The fifth chapter through the analysis for the relevant maritime law experts’ opinion intheory and the shipping industry in our country, objectively comes to the affirmativeconclusion that we should alter the maritime law by introducing the maritime performingparty regime. And this paper sums up a construction mode of maritime performing partyregime in our country according to our national conditions and the shipping practice--directly, flexibly introducing maritime performing party regime in our maritime law.
